如何使用RESTEasy创建自定义原子链接?

时间:2011-10-14 09:33:09

标签: java resteasy

我想知道是否(以及如果是这样,如何)可以使RESTEasy返回一个带有自定义原子链接的对象,例如分页时指向下一页/上一页的链接,特别是我想得到的东西类似于以下内容:

<collection>
    <start>4</start>
    <values>4</values>
    <total>20</total>

    <item>...</item>
    <item>...</item>
    <item>...</item>
    <item>...</item>

    <atom:link rel="next" href="...?page=3"/>
    <atom:link rel="previous" href="...?page=1"/>
    <atom:link rel="first" href="...?page=1"/>
    <atom:link rel="last" href="...?page=5"/>
</collection>

我已经找到了如何为发现提供链接,但如果可能的话,制作这样的自定义链接似乎更复杂。

1 个答案:

答案 0 :(得分:0)

最后,我最终使用<any/>元素并创建自己的元素以插入到JAXB对象的任何字段中。那seems to have its own problems,但至少还有一步。